UPI opened when I have already paid for and received the item

Hi, yesterday I received notification from ebay that a UPI has been opened against me for an item I bought and paid for a month ago, and which I have received. The seller is in the US and has not responded to the email I sent her querying the UPI. Ebay customer support has not helped, they just sent a generic response about contacting the seller to resolve it and leaving feedback for them (which I had already done - positive feedback when I received the item). I provided details of my paypal payment to ebay together with copies of emails from paypal and from the seller when she advised the item had been posted, and asked them to close the UPI, but they have apparently ignored this evidence and really done nothing to help. Can anybody out there offer any advice? I don't want a strike against me when I have paid.

Re: UPI opened when I have already paid for and received the item

In the UPI, you will need to respond.


 


In the response, state clearly that this item has been paid for and posted and received and the transaction was finalised on (insert date).


 


Also, it could be just an US site glitch.


 


Either way, you wont end up with a permanent strike, as it can be removed, so don't fret.

Re: UPI opened when I have already paid for and received the item

Thanks everyone for your advice, I'm pursuing it further through ebay as suggested. I only bought one item, once, and yes I did pay directly through paypal - I couldn't go through checkout as normal because the international postage wasn't there and the seller said she was having problems sending an invoice. Possibly she didn't mark the item as paid at her end and the UPI happened automatically - (?). Can't think of any reason she'd do it otherwise - the transaction was completed, I received the item, left pos feedback....and it's not like I'm now going to pay her again!
